Most teams in the NFL received their final roster and ratings update for Madden NFL 12 a week ago. Now on Friday, the update for the Divisional Round of the 2012 NFL Playoffs is set to go live for Xbox 360 and PS3 users. While other teams that weren't in the playoffs will still get changes to the roster as Madden catches up, there's not going to be anymore changes to overall player rating for said teams. The Detroit Lions will see some changes in the update, though they're not all good ones.
There's nine changes overall for Detroit in this update, and all of them pertain to player rating. Unfortunately, the majority of those changes are on the negative side, with only four players going up in rating. Increases
QB Matthew Stafford 89 to 90
WR Calvin Johnson 98 to 99
DL Sammie Hill 76 to 77
CB Aaron Berry 64 to 66
Decreases
DL Corey Williams 83 to 82
DL Ndamukong Suh 93 to 92
DL Cliff Avril 86 to 84
S Amari Spievey 80 to 79
S Louis Delmas 84 to 83
